AskBio Inc., a wholly owned and independently operated subsidiary of Bayer AG, is a fully integrated gene therapy company dedicated to developing life-saving medicines and changing lives. The company maintains a portfolio of clinical programs across a range of neuromuscular, central nervous system, cardiovascular, and metabolic disease indications with a clinical-stage pipeline that includes investigational therapeutics for congestive heart failure, limb-girdle muscular dystrophy, multiple system atrophy, Parkinson’s disease, and Pompe disease. AskBio’s gene therapy platform includes Pro10™, an industry-leading proprietary cell line manufacturing process, and an extensive array of capsids and promoters. With global headquarters in Research Triangle Park, North Carolina, and European headquarters in Edinburgh, Scotland, the company has generated hundreds of proprietary capsids and promoters, several of which have entered pre-clinical and clinical testing.

Job Responsibilities
Maintain and build upon a culture of safety and compliance by ensuring adherence to and continuous improvement of all related procedures and policies
Manage quality records (Change Controls, SOPs, Deviations, CAPAs, Training) related to scientific facility and equipment operations, driving efforts to standardize quality operations within the team
Accountable for the development, budget, and compliance of the site’s metrology and calibration program, managing the internal calibration team and contractors
Collaborate with research teams to align facility services with team needs and support the development of SMEs within the team
Create and control budget for calibration and instrument services
Balance in-house work with contracted work by using sound financial analysis
Manage, negotiate, and maintain vendor contracts, service level agreements (SLAs), and the budget for all scientific equipment, instruments, and related services
Act as a Subject Matter Expert (SME) to optimize the CMMS configuration and workflows specifically for laboratory asset management and calibration activities
Apply operational excellence principles to the management of assets from onboarding to retirement to drive value for AskBio
Minimum Requirements
Bachelor’s degree in facilities management or related field
6+ years’ experience in managing calibration and instrumentation teams
5+ years’ experience in GxP laboratories and facilities
A proven track record of solving problems methodically and efficiently
Ability to create clear process maps, work instructions, job plans and procedures
Strong collaborative skills with the ability to influence across multiple departments
Preferred Education, Experience and Skills
Strong Operational Excellence foundation with applicable certifications (e.g., CMRP, Six-Sigma)
Calibration and/ or Instrumentation Certification
